Enrolled Learning Modules How do I see and access the courses I m enrolled in? 15
Enrolled Learning Modules Let s review the Enrolled Learning Modules page. To access this page users must click on the Enrolled Learning Modules tab. 16
Enrolled Learning Modules After clicking the Enrolled Learning Modules tab notice the tab has turned from red to blue? You are now on the Enrolled Learning page. Blue tabs indicate your current location. 17
Enrolled Learning Modules From this page you may view ALL the courses you are currently enrolled in, classroom and online. 18
Enrolled Learning Modules Courses that are listed as ENROLLED are courses that you are enrolled in but have not tried to access or complete. 19
Enrolled Learning Modules Courses that are listed as INCOMPLETE are courses that you are enrolled in and are in the process of completing. For example, if you launch a module but wish to complete the course at a different time the Learning Center will mark the course as INCOMPLETE. 20
Enrolled Learning Modules To launch or access an online training module click the course title. Course Title 21
Enrolled Learning Modules Once you click the course title a new window will open providing the course summary and a Start Module link. Upon clicking the Start Module link the course will launch. 22
Enrolled Learning Modules Start Module Screen Once you have started the training module DO NOT close the Start Module screen. Doing so may result in failure to receive credit for the course. 23
Enrolled Learning Modules When exiting a module that includes an exam please remember to click the EXIT button in the bottom left hand corner. Failure to do so may result in not receiving credit for the course. 24
Enrolled Learning Modules To review information about a classroom training click the course title. Course Title 25
Enrolled Learning Modules Once you click the course title a new window will open providing information on the classroom training. 26
Enrolled Learning Modules From the Enrolled Learning Modules page students may also view their training calendar. Students may view training for any month. 27
Records/Transcript How can I view my training history? I want to view both completed and incomplete training. 28
Record/Transcript Click the Records/Transcript tab to review the Records/Transcript page. Notice the Record/Transcript tab is blue. Again, a blue tab indicates your current location. 29
Records/Transcript The Records/Transcript page allows students to view their complete training history. 30
Records/Transcript By default the page initially displays records for the past twelve months. To view a complete history click the Show Learning Items For drop down menu. 31
Records/Transcript The Overall Status column indicates whether you have or have not completed a course. 32
